Alright, so let’s move onto what keeps you busy professionally?
I found my voice as an artist while sitting in my studio in New York City in January of 2014. I was very uncomfortable with my life at the time. I was in a painful and disconnected marriage. I’d been trying to get pregnant for years with no success. I had suffered a miscarriage. My parents were going through some scary health issues. I would sit in my studio with fresh flowers, drawing and painting as a way to emotionally regulate. One afternoon, I was playing with fresh flowers and clipped the head of a bright orange Ranunculus and placed it on top of a photograph of a pair of bare legs. I loved how it looked! I immediately began creating all kinds of Flowers With Legs using Hydrangeas, Peonies, Gerbera Daisies, Orchids. When I ran out of photographs of bare legs I began drawing legs and arms and began painting designer shoes on them all. There it was! My voice as an artist. Flowers With Legs was born.

When I was in the hospital when my son was finally born, I had to be there for two months on bed rest and then in the NICU. It was such a scary time. I began creating my Flowers With Legs using some of the fresh flowers I had been sent by friends and family. The nurses and doctors would stop by my room all the time to view my new paintings. I overheard one of the nurses say to her colleague, “she came here for us to heal her but she’s healing us.” I think that’s what really sets my artwork apart. It has a healing quality, not only for me but for others. I call my work Flowers With Legs, Art That Heels the Sole which is a play on words because usually they have feet and designer heels.

My work is created through self awareness, emotional regulation and play. I give myself the time and space I need to connect to how I’m feeling first before I get to work in the studio to invent and discover. The process is daunting and sometimes painful but it can also be exciting and energizing and have great results! The biggest challenge for me has been time management and knowing what is important each day. As a self employed artist, there isn’t anyone standing over me with demands and deadlines, it’s up to me to set priorities and meet my own goals. I get out of it what I put into it. I’m learning that routine and treating it as
a typical 9-5 job is crucial to getting to where I want to be.
